Falmouth Maritime Museum

The former Port Pendennis site in Falmouth has been transformed into a major new visitor attraction, including a new landmark building to house the National Maritime Museum of Cornwall. Carrick District Council gave the go­ahead to the detailed plans for the site which received £10 million from the Heritage Lottery fund.
